INTRODUCTION
A person may be injured at mechanical equipments
through:
i. Coming into contact with it, or being trapped
between the machinery or any fixed structure
ii. Being struck by, or becoming entangled in motion in
the equipments / machineries
iii.Being struck by parts of the tools / machineries
ejected from it
iv.Being struck by materials ejected from the machinery
or tools
For power tools, selection & incorrect use is very
important in percentage number of accidents
Materials handling equipments are very dangerous if not
being managed or maintained properly

TYPES OF GUARDS
i. Fixed Guards

A permanent part of the machine


Usually made of sheet metal, screen,
bars or other material which will
withstand the anticipated impact
Preferred type of guard.

ii. Interlocked Guard

Usually connected to a mechanism that will cut off the


power automatically
Could use electrical, mechanical or hydraulic systems
Should rely on a manual reset system

Adjustable Guard

Very flexible to accommodate various


types of stock.
Manually adjusted

Self-Adjusting

The opening is determined by


the movement of the stock
through the guard.
Does not always provide
maximum protection.

The top clearance on a bench

grinder should not exceed 1/4


inch.
Bench Grinders require a work
rest with a maximum clearance of
1/8 inch to insure that the work
does not get drawn into the
grinding wheel.

Power Tool Hazards

All hazards involved in the use of power

tools can be prevented by following five


basic safety rules:

Keep all tools in good condition


with regular maintenance.
Use the right tool for the job.
Examine each tool for damage
before use.
Operate according to the
manufacturer's instructions.
Provide and use the proper
protective equipment.

FORKLIFT SAFETY
Forklifts are very useful for moving raw materials, tools and

equipment in many industries.


These accidents result from:

Lack of operator training


Poor maintenance
No safe systems of work.

OPERATORS
Selection of operators
Physical and mental fitness
Training

Basic, job specific & familiarization


Authorization to operate

Written permission
Driver competency Cert. & continuous assessment
Lockable ignition & key holder

MAINTENANCE

Must do daily checking on system & main components

System :

Hydraulics
Brakes
Battery
Lights
Steering

Components :

Tyre pressure
Brakes / hand break
Horn
Lights / beacon
Fuel

SYSTEM OF WORKS
DO NOT

Pick up a load if someone is standing close


Allow people to walk underneath the load
Try to pick up an unsuitable load
Leave a lift truck unattended with the engine running
Carry passengers
Operate with the load raised except at creep speed
Drive forward is visibility is impaired by a load

DOS

Only issue keys to authorized drivers


On completion of work, park lift truck in
designated area
Be careful with pedestrians / obey site rules /
speed limits
Sound horn at potential danger spots
Stop before entering building, sound horn then
proceed
Avoid violent breaking
Always travel with the forks roughly 150 mm
above ground level
Travel slowly down slopes with the fork facing
uphill
Before you raise a load check over head for
obstructions
